Abstract
The invention provides a full-plastic diaphragm valve with an irregular diaphragm. The full-plastic diaphragm valve mainly comprises a hand wheel, a valve rod, a floating nut, an upper valve body, a lower valve body, the diaphragm, valve flaps, a valve deck and a fixing piece. The hand wheel is located above the valve deck, and the fixing piece penetrates through the hand wheel to be connected with the valve deck. The valve rod is located in the valve deck. The floating nut is located on the valve rod. The valve flaps are located below the floating nut. The upper valve body is located below the valve deck. The diaphragm is located below the valve flaps. The lower valve body is located below the diaphragm. The diaphragm is of a concave structure. A diaphragm concave part is arranged on the diaphragm. One end of the valve rod is connected with the hand wheel, and the other end of the valve rod is connected with the diaphragm. The end, connected with the diaphragm, of the valve rod is of a forky structure. The full-plastic diaphragm valve with the irregular diaphragm has the advantages of being good in stability and in sealing effect, excellent in use performance, low in manufacturing cost, and long in service life.

Background technique
Membrane valve is one of charge valve commonly used in industrial stokehold.Membrane valve septation is important component, also be very easy to consume simultaneously, because existing barrier film is all fixing plane structure, the contraction operation of self cannot be carried out when pressurized, so just easily there is the excessive situation of pressurized, produce unnecessary consume, reduce outside working life, also results in the reduction of stability; Existing membrane valve is all directly think that barrier film is exerted pressure by valve rod, area due to valve rod is less than the area of barrier film, so just greatly reduce sealing effect during membrane valve operation, the direct contact of valve rod simultaneously also allows barrier film be more prone to be damaged, in addition, in existing membrane valve, the parts major part such as valve rod is all the stainless steel adopted, and more than like this manufacture cost that adds, also there will be situations such as getting rusty.
